V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
V2EX 提问指南
ghostwind
V2EX  ›  问与答

大佬们,有比较适合大字段(text)的 db 方案么,读多写少场景

  •  
  •   ghostwind · 2018-04-26 20:57:30 +08:00 · 1891 次点击
    这是一个创建于 2405 天前的主题,其中的信息可能已经有所发展或是发生改变。

    现在用的是 mysql 的 text,当当数据量大的时候可能会有一些性能问题。如果说想换一个另外的数据库有什么比较好的方案么。

    举例来说,淘宝的内容详情页,或者是 jd 的内容详情页里的内容是用什么样的存储方案啊。

    7 条回复    2018-04-27 08:42:24 +08:00
    alvinbone88
        1
    alvinbone88  
       2018-04-26 23:09:26 +08:00
    配置读写分离
    如果读得比较多,可以多配置几个从库
    misaka19000
        2
    misaka19000  
       2018-04-26 23:09:59 +08:00
    ES
    billlee
        3
    billlee  
       2018-04-26 23:11:38 +08:00
    我的思路是
    1. 在 MySQL 内,可以分区、分表、分库
    2. 如果访问集中,可以加缓存
    3. 换 key-value 数据库
    msg7086
        4
    msg7086  
       2018-04-27 01:05:00 +08:00
    不如先说说剂量?
    多大的字段,多少行,单表做出来多大,对数据处理有没有额外的要求?
    prolic
        5
    prolic  
       2018-04-27 01:32:35 +08:00 via Android
    说下具体场景啊,根据单 key 大小,查询需求,总数据量才能决定 pgsql,mongo,hbase 还是再到其他的什么东西
    Nick2VIPUser
        6
    Nick2VIPUser  
       2018-04-27 08:27:08 +08:00 via iPhone
    mongodb
    csl1995
        7
    csl1995  
       2018-04-27 08:42:24 +08:00 via iPhone
    有钱换 oracle,没钱用 mycat 作分库分表。优化索引,优化 sql。提高硬件配置,读写分离,加缓存。
    你要给个具体场景和情况啊,不然定位不到瓶颈。
    还有数据量大肯定有一定时延问题,关键看你们应用的容忍度,优化到一定程度即可。
    关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   1479 人在线   最高记录 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 26ms · UTC 17:10 · PVG 01:10 · LAX 09:10 · JFK 12:10
    Developed with CodeLauncher
    ♥ Do have faith in what you're doing.